Recent studies have shown that well-maintained gardening and tree cover can increase the value of your home by up to 30 percent. Even simply improving your current garden from “good” to “excellent” can increase the value of your home by 6 or 7 percent. The imposing trees on your property provide more than beauty — they increase the value of your home. Several recent national surveys show that mature trees in a well-landscaped yard can increase the value of a home by 7 to 19 percent.
Tree cover and landscaping, if done right, can significantly increase the value of your home, while poorly maintained or unmaintained trees and landscaping can have the opposite effect.
